inhumane

Definition of inhumane

in`hu`mane´   Pronunciation: ĭn`hū`mān´
adj.1.not humane; lacking and reflecting lack of pity, kindness, or compassion; as, humans are innately inhumane; this explains much of the misery and suffering in the world; biological weapons are considered too inhumane to be used.
